#559eaa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#559eaa is composed of 33.3% red, 62%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 188.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 50%. #559eaa color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ffff with #003d55.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#559eaa color description : Dark moderate cyan.

#559eaa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#559eaa has RGB values of R:85, G:158, B:170 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 5611178.

Shades and Tints of #559eaa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c0d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#559eaa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8283 is the less saturated color, while #07d6f8 is the most saturated one.
